Manchester United are struggling to secure a spot in the top 4 of the English Premier League for the 2021-2022 season.

Some 3 months ago, Ole Gunnar Solskjaer – who’s birthday is today- was sacked from managing Manchester United after a 4:1 defeat to Watford, away from Old Trafford. It seems the shadows of Solskjaer is still lurking around the club.

Today, Manchester United failed to score a goal in the second leg fixture against Watford at Old Trafford and were somewhat fortunate to secure a draw at the end of the match.

It may be an improvement compared to the scoreline some 3 months ago, but it is the same story that things have not gotten better at the Club even with the signing of Ronaldo, Raphael Varane, and an interim coach.

One would think that with Arsenal and Tottenham, who are behind United, having outstanding games to play, United would keep collecting these points to put them on a lifeline before the worse happens.

Even though Manchester United are sitting in 4th position on the league table, looking at next couple of games Manchester United have to play, things seem to be even worse if they continue with this kind of performance.

Manchester United will be meeting Manchester City, Tottenham, Liverpool, Leicester, and Everton in the next 5 fixtures. This may look good for football fans around the world, but it would be a tough period for the struggling Red side of Manchester.
